LIT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2023 in Review

376 of the 6,859 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Global X Lithium & Battery Tech ETF (LIT) for Q4 2023, worth a combined $469M — down 21% from $592M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 69 funds closed out of LIT and 66 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 153 trimmed existing stakes and 61 added.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$19.1M. The largest seller was Jane Street, cutting an estimated $21.7M.
